Xonotlite Vs Prase Opal Fracture

Fracture is an important parameter when you compare Xonotlite and Prase Opal Physical Properties. It is necessary to understand the significance of these properties, before you compare Xonotlite Vs Prase Opal fracture. Whenever a gemstone chip breaks, it leaves a characteristic line along its breakage. Such lines are known as fracture and are used to identify the gemstones in their initial stages of production when they are in the form of rough minerals. Fracture is usually described with the terms “fibrous” and “splintery” to denote a fracture that usually leaves elongated and sharp edges. Fracture observed in Xonotlite is Fibrous. Prase Opal fracture is Conchoidal.
